Six hundred seventy-six patients with ductal carcinoma in situ of the breast (DCIS) from 1971 to 1995 were included in the study. Computerized patient files were retrospectively analyzed. Clinical findings were less frequently reported to reveal DCIS after 1989. Positive mammographic findings were obtained in 87% of patients and were mainly represented by microcalcifications (79.4%). Treatment procedures were breast-conserving surgery (BCS) alone (37.5%), BCS followed by radiation (BCSR) (25.5%), or mastectomy (M) (37%). The actuarial local recurrence was 2.6% in the M group (94 months of follow-up), 14.5% in the BCS group (85,7 months of follow-up), and 7.5% in the BCSR group (78.8 months of follow-up). Predictive factors of recurrence in all patients were invaded margin status and age. In the BCS group, grade was also a predictive factor. The analysis per decade shows that the lesions currently diagnosed are less serious than those of the past. All the recurrence in patients with positive margins was in the same quadrant as the original lesion. This further emphasizes the need for clear margins.
BackgroundWhen invasive components are discovered at mastectomy for vacuum-assisted biopsy (VAB)-diagnosed ductal carcinoma in situ (DCIS), the only option available is axillary lymph node dissection (ALND). The primary aim of this prospective multicenter trial was to determine the benefit of performing upfront sentinel lymph node (SLN) biopsy for these patients. The secondary aim was to determine DCIS factors associated with microinvasion or invasion.MethodsThe SLN procedure was performed during mastectomy, and for positive SLN an ALND was performed during the same intervention. A tissue microarray containing DCIS lesions from the mastectomy specimens was subsequently performed.ResultsFrom May 2008 to December 2010, 228 patients were enrolled from 14 French cancer centers, including 192 eligible patients with pure DCIS on VAB and successful SLN procedures. ALND was avoided for 51 [67 %; 95 % confidence interval (CI), 56–77 %] of all the patients who had microinvasive DCIS or DCIS associated with invasive carcinoma at mastectomy and a negative SLN. Of the 192 patients, 76 (39 %) with VAB-diagnosed DCIS were upgraded after mastectomy to micro (n = 20) or invasive disease (n = 56). The rate of positive SLN for patients with DCIS on VAB was 14 %. High nuclear grade of DCIS was associated with greater risk of microinvasion and invasion, and HER2-amplified DCIS was associated with greater risk of invasion.ConclusionsUnderestimation of invasive components is high when DCIS is diagnosed by VAB in patients undergoing mastectomy.
